Ordinals
beta
Sat 844897232155262
decimal
168979.2232155262
degree
0°168979′1651″2232155262‴
percentile
40.233201575459496%
name
hwdflqppikp
cycle
0
epoch
0
period
83
block
168979
offset
2232155262
timestamp
2012-02-29 02:13:21 UTC
rarity
common
prev
next